
The Neurobiology of Flow: Decoding the Science of Peak Performance
In the quest for peak performance, most people focus on willpower while ignoring the biological machinery that actually drives focus. Dr. Steven Kotler explains that the elusive 'flow state' isn't a gift of the elite, but a repeatable neurobiological process triggered by specific environmental and internal conditions. By understanding how to balance challenge against skill and leveraging the 90-minute focus cycle, you can stop fighting your brain and start using it as the high-output engine it was evolved to be.
